  • the aforementioned structure is an underlying, supporting structural part of a building in which said window or said door is accommodated, said structural part ensuring the strength and rigidity of this building.
  • This may be, for example, a load-bearing wall or a frame, etc.
  • Such a window or such a door may be a separate window or a separate door, but may also be configured as a set of windows.
  • Such a window or such a door is understood to refer to both the window or door profiles and the filling of these window or door profiles in the form of glazing and/or panels, etc.
  • Models of such screen casings are known which should be fastened at various positions at the top of such a window or door depending on circumstances.
  • a plurality of different fastening means is provided in practice for fastening such screen casings. Because different types of fastening means are required, in practice the screen casings are not always mounted with the most suitable fastening means, wherein the required security cannot always be guaranteed.
  • such a screen casing is fastened to profiles of such a window or door, typically by means of screws distributed over the length. Where this is not possible, or where energy considerations do not allow, such a screen casing must be fastened in a zone next to and above such a window or door, leaving an opening above said window.
  • the structure can be accessed directly for fastening the screen casing Then the screen casing may for example itself be fastened to said structure with several screws, wherein also fastening brackets may be used. In said cases, these are not always positioned judiciously.
  • the screen casing is fastened using a first fastening bracket which can be fastened to the screen casing, and a second fastening bracket which can be fastened to a window or door or surrounding structure, wherein said fastening brackets can be fastened together.
  • first fastening bracket which can be fastened to the screen casing
  • second fastening bracket which can be fastened to a window or door or surrounding structure
  • the object of this invention is to provide fastening means with which different types of such screen casings can be fastened easily and securely under various circumstances.
  • this height adjustment it is possible to use the same fastening means for different types of screen casing and in very different circumstances, in order to fasten a screen casing of such a screen device to a window or door or a structure. With this height adjustment, it is now possible to adjust the height of the screen casing relative to the upper edge of the window or door to be covered.
  • the first fastening brackets may in some cases be premounted on the screw casing in a workshop, wherein the second bracket may be fastened at the desired position on site, and wherein the two fastening brackets may then be fastened at the desired height relative to one another.

Claims (11)

  1. Anordnung:
    - einer Schirmvorrichtung (1), umfassend
    • einen Schirm (3), der auf eine Schirmrolle (2) auf- und von dieser abgerollt werden kann, um ein Fenster oder eine Tür (5) abzudecken; und
    • ein Schirmgehäuse (4, 4', 4"), in dem diese Schirmrolle (2) so untergebracht ist, dass sie drehbar ist; und
    - Befestigungsmittel zur Befestigung des Schirmgehäuses (4, 4', 4") an dem Fenster oder der Tür (5) oder einer Struktur (7), in der das Fenster oder die Tür (5) montiert ist, umfassend:
    • einen ersten Befestigungsbügel (8), der zur Befestigung an dem Schirmgehäuse (4, 4', 4") bereitgestellt ist; und
    • einen zweiten Befestigungsbügel (9, 9', 9"), der zur Befestigung an dem Fenster oder der Tür (5) oder der Struktur (7) bereitgestellt ist und der an dem ersten Befestigungsbügel (8) befestigbar ist;
    wobei die Befestigungsmittel Einstellmittel zum Einstellen der gegenseitigen Befestigung dieser Befestigungsbügel (8, 9, 9', 9") in einer Höhenrichtung (H) umfassen; dadurch gekennzeichnet, dass das Schirmgehäuse ein erstes Schirmgehäuse (4, 4") ist und mit Bügeleinhakmitteln (26, 27) versehen ist, oder dass das Gehäuse ein zweites Schirmgehäuse (4') ist und frei von solchen Bügeleinhakmitteln (26, 27) ist, und dass der erste Befestigungsbügel (8):
    - in einer ersten Position an dem zweiten Befestigungsbügel (9, 9', 9") befestigbar und mit Gehäuseeinhakmitteln (11) versehen ist, um sich in der ersten Position an den Bügeleinhakmitteln (26, 27) an dem ersten Schirmgehäuse (4, 4") einzuhaken; und
    - in einer zweiten Position am zweiten Befestigungsbügel (9, 9', 9") befestigbar und mit einem Hakenelement (10) versehen ist, um sich in dieser zweiten Position an der Oberseite des zweiten Schirmgehäuses (4') einzuhaken.
